Bison women win team title at Mark Colligan Memorial

North Dakota State's women's track and field team captured the team title at the Mark Colligan Memorial indoor meet on January 24, defeating host Nebraska, Boise State, and Wichita State. Nebraska's men finished first in their division, highlighted by dominant performances in throwing events. Standout results included school records and personal bests across multiple disciplines.

North Dakota State freshman Carter Reckelberg secured the conference championship in the long jump during the first day of the Summit League men's track and field competition. His victory highlighted the performance of the Bison team. Several other NDSU athletes participated in the event.

Junior Jayden Murdock of North Dakota State University recorded a personal-best time of 21.72 seconds in the 200m dash, securing second place at the UND Tune-Up. This mark ranks eighth on the NDSU all-time list for the event. The meet featured several Bison men's track and field athletes.
